Skip to content

Tabs: support passing additional props to each tab button through tabTriggerProps#565

Merged
mkrause merged 3 commits intomasterfrom
mkrause/260107-tabs-support-rest-props
Jan 7, 2026
Merged

Tabs: support passing additional props to each tab button through tabTriggerProps#565
mkrause merged 3 commits intomasterfrom
mkrause/260107-tabs-support-rest-props

Conversation

@mkrause
Copy link
Collaborator

@mkrause mkrause commented Jan 7, 2026

This PR:

  • Adds a new tabTriggerProps prop to the Tab component, which allows consumers to pass additional props to each tab trigger button.
  • Refactors Tabs.stories.tsx + add a new story for custom tab props
  • Fixes a bug in Tabs.stories.tsx where defaultActiveTabKey was not working

@mkrause mkrause requested a review from spli02 January 7, 2026 13:47
@mkrause mkrause self-assigned this Jan 7, 2026
@mkrause mkrause added this to the Baklava v1.0 milestone Jan 7, 2026
@mkrause mkrause mentioned this pull request Jan 7, 2026
8 tasks
@mkrause mkrause merged commit b8b2973 into master Jan 7, 2026
4 checks passed
@mkrause mkrause deleted the mkrause/260107-tabs-support-rest-props branch January 7, 2026 14:08
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ants